Thông số kỹ thuật
| thuộc tính | Giá trị |
| Package | Tray |
| Series | Cyclone® |
| ProductStatus | Obsolete |
| NumberofLABs/CLBs | 2006 |
| NumberofLogicElements/Cells | 20060 |
| TotalRAMBits | 294912 |
| NumberofI/O | 233 |
| Voltage-Supply | 1.425V ~ 1.575V |
| MountingType | Surface Mount |
| OperatingTemperature | 0°C ~ 85°C (TJ) |
| Package/Case | 324-BGA |

Description
The EP1C20F324C8N is a member of the Cyclone FPGA family by Altera (now part of Intel). It is designed for cost-sensitive applications that require low power consumption and flexible design capabilities. The device features 20,060 logic elements, 52 embedded 18x18 multipliers, and 294,912 RAM bits, making it suitable for a variety of digital circuit designs.
The EP1C20F324C8N is housed in a 324-pin FineLine BGA package, facilitating compact and efficient designs. It supports a wide range of user I/Os, which are ideal for designs requiring extensive interfacing with external components. The device operates at a core voltage of 1.5V and supports multiple I/O standards, providing versatility in communication protocols.
With its support for in-system programmability, the EP1C20F324C8N enables rapid prototyping and easy updates without needing to remove the device from the circuit board. The Cyclone family offers a balance between performance, low power, and cost, making it suitable for applications in automotive, industrial, and consumer electronics sectors.

Features
The EP1C20F324C8N is a member of the Cyclone family of FPGAs by Altera, now part of Intel. Key features include:
1. Logic Elements: It comprises 20,060 Logic Elements (LEs), providing a flexible platform for implementing custom digital circuits.
2. Embedded Memory: The FPGA includes 294,912 RAM bits, facilitating efficient data storage and processing within the device.
3. I/O Pins: It has 249 user I/O pins, which offer various interfacing options with external devices and systems.
4. Clock Management: The device features four phase-locked loops (PLLs) for precise clock management, essential for timing-critical applications.
5. Package: It comes in a 324-pin FineLine BGA package, which supports high-density applications in a compact form factor.
6. Power: Designed for low power consumption, making it suitable for cost-sensitive and portable applications.
7. Applications: It is often used in consumer electronics, communication systems, and industrial applications due to its balance of performance and cost-effectiveness.
These features make the EP1C20F324C8N versatile for a wide range of digital design applications.

Manufacturer
The EP1C20F324C8N is manufactured by Altera Corporation, which is now part of Intel Corporation. Altera was a company known for designing and manufacturing programmable logic devices, including FPGAs (Field-Programmable Gate Arrays), CPLDs (Complex Programmable Logic Devices), and related products. In 2015, Altera was acquired by Intel, and its product lines were integrated into Intel's Programmable Solutions Group.
